DESCRIPTION
The STPS1L30UPbF surface mount Schottky rectifier
has been designed for applications requiring low
forward drop and small foot prints on PC board. Typical
applications are in disk drives, switching power supplies,
converters, freewheeling diodes, battery charging, and
reverse battery protection.
